Background:

FCA works to enable people to break the circle of poverty and violence. We are a rights-based actor, a Finnish organization with 70 year

s of experience, with operations in 15 countries. FCA is Finland’s largest NGO in development cooperation and second largest provider of disaster relief. Our action is guided by international human rights standards and principles. We realize our mission and vision through development cooperation, humanitarian assistance and advocacy work. We contribute to positive change by supporting people in the most vulnerable situations within fragile and disaster-affected areas. We consider three thematic areas as central to sustainable change: the right to peace (R2P), livelihood (R2L) and quality education (R2QE).

In Somalia and Somaliland FCA has been working under a right to peace thematic areas since 2008 including governance and reconciliation projects and later has expanded in quality education (R2QE) thematic area.

Primary purpose of the position:

The Education project Assistant – under the guidance of Project Officer is responsible for the planning, implementing, monitoring and reporting of FCA implemented education projects. He/she will ensure efficient utilization of project resources for the intended purpose through effective planning and monitoring. He or she will ensure the use of appropriate, cost effective and innovative approaches.

He or she will ensure synergy through collaboration and networking with other stakeholders implementing education programme in his/her area of operation. Education project Assistant will ensure partnership with relevant partners including ministry of education including district education officers (DEOs), regional education officers (REO), and with Community Education Committees at community level. Education Officer shall ensure linkage among education and other thematic areas at field level. He or she will play key role in representing FCA in relevant networks and forums and engage in advocacy and dialogue with relevant education stakeholders at region and district level.
